
Okay, we know that by far, the best way to stay “safe” – regarding Bisphenol-A (BPA) exposure – is to not eat or drink anything that’s in a plastic bottle (and/or can)… but be aware that BPA can also be found in:
- Boxed wine
(using plastic liners inside them) - Canned goods
- Cash register receipts
- Compact Discs
- Dental Sealants
- Toilet Paper
- Toys
